Perform a variety of braille translation and transcription functions and activities; prepare braille copies of instructional materials and instructional aids for use by visually impaired students; emboss, re-edit, and bind materials using various methods; review student work that has been completed in braille; create tactile graphics of maps, charts, pictures, routes, and other tactile displays using various tools, materials, and machines; provide instructional support to students who are learning braille; perform routine clerical duties.

Education: One of the following: 1) Completion of an Associate of arts (AA) degree; 2) 48 units of course work at the college level. 3) High school graduation or equivalent GED, and the successful completion of a comprehensive exam in the areas of reading, math, and written language.
Experience: One (1) year of experience in the operation of a braille writer.
Licenses, Certifications, and other requirements:
• Valid Braille certification issued by the Library of Congress or submission of manuscript in progress.
• Valid California Class C driver’s license.
• Proof of current and valid Tuberculosis screening.
